What esignature for lead management for inventory means for operations

eSignature for lead management for inventory refers to using electronic signatures and related document workflows to capture authorizations, confirm purchase intents, and finalize inventory-related agreements. It connects lead intake, quote approval, and inventory allocation so approvals occur before stock is committed. Integrations with CRMs and inventory systems reduce manual entry, while automated reminders and templates shorten cycle times. For U.S.-based organizations, an eSignature workflow also supports audit trails and access controls needed for compliance and internal governance across sales, procurement, and warehouse teams.

Common operational challenges addressed

  • Manual approvals cause delays that can lead to reserved or oversold inventory and missed sales opportunities.
  • Disconnected CRMs and warehouses require duplicate data entry, increasing risk of pricing or SKU mismatches.
  • Inconsistent document formats make it hard to validate signatures and track signed terms across teams.
  • Insufficient audit detail can complicate disputes, returns, and compliance with U.S. electronic signature laws.

Key features that support lead-to-inventory eSign workflows

Effective eSignature solutions include automation, integrations, robust security, and flexible signing methods that together reduce processing time and errors when converting leads into inventory commitments.

Template Library

Reusable, field-mapped templates allow teams to standardize quotes and purchase orders so document creation is fast and consistent across sales and procurement.

Bulk Send

Bulk Send enables sending the same inventory authorization or recall notice to many recipients while tracking individual responses and signatures centrally for auditability.

API Integration

APIs connect the eSignature system with CRM and inventory platforms to automate population of lead data and to trigger allocation updates on signing.

Conditional Fields

Conditional logic displays inventory-specific clauses or pricing based on lead attributes and available stock, reducing manual edits and signing errors.

Audit Trail

Comprehensive event logs capture timestamps, IP addresses, and signer actions to support compliance, dispute resolution, and internal review.

Mobile Signing

Mobile-optimized signing flows let customers and suppliers sign from phones or tablets, keeping conversion rates high and approvals timely.

Practical use cases in inventory and lead workflows

Two concise examples show how eSignatures reduce errors and speed lead-to-fulfillment cycles.

Sales Quote Approval

A field sales rep generates a quote linked to inventory availability using CRM data

  • The system applies a templated agreement and requests customer signature
  • Signed agreement immediately triggers reserve and pick instructions in the warehouse

Resulting in faster fulfillment and reduced double-booked stock for subsequent orders.

Supplier Replenishment Confirmation

Procurement issues a purchase order that includes inventory thresholds and delivery windows

  • Supplier reviews and signs the PO electronically
  • Signed PO automatically updates inventory forecasting and inbound schedules

Leading to clearer supplier commitments and fewer stockouts during high-demand periods.

Best practices for secure, accurate eSignatures in inventory workflows

Follow these operational and security practices to ensure signatures are legally valid and inventory commitments are accurate and auditable.

Standardize templates and fields across teams
Use organization-wide templates with required fields for SKU, quantity, and delivery dates to eliminate ambiguity and speed processing from signed agreement to order fulfillment.
Enforce signer authentication and roles
Require email verification or stronger authentication for personnel who authorize stock moves, and use role-based access to limit who can change template terms.
Keep an immutable audit trail for each transaction
Record timestamps, IP addresses, and change histories for every document to support compliance with ESIGN and to resolve any disputes about inventory allocations.
Test integrations and error handling
Validate CRM and inventory system mappings in a sandbox environment, and define fallback procedures if automated updates fail to prevent inventory inconsistencies.
